Job description

Job Summary

Lead Mechanical Design (Thermal Simulator) Engineer would involve using simulation tools to analyze the thermal performance of optical transceivers, ensuring they meet design specifications and operational requirements. Key responsibilities include conducting thermal simulations, validating results with testing, and collaborating with design and manufacturing teams to optimize thermal performance.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Thermal Simulations:
    • Performing thermal simulations using software tools (e.g., Solidworks, ANSYS, COMSOL) to analyze heat transfer, temperature distribution, and thermal stresses within optical transceivers.
    • Creating and refining thermal models based on component specifications, operating conditions, and environmental factors.
    • Analyzing simulation results to identify potential thermal issues, bottlenecks, and areas for improvement.
  • Validation and Characterization:
    • Developing and executing thermal validation tests to verify simulation accuracy and assess thermal performance under different operating conditions.
    • Characterizing the thermal behavior of optical transceivers, including temperature rise, thermal gradients, and thermal resistance.
    • Documenting test results and comparing them with simulation predictions to refine models and design parameters.
  • Collaboration and Optimization:
    • Working closely with design and manufacturing teams to integrate thermal considerations into the design process.
    • Identifying and implementing thermal management solutions, such as heat sinks, thermal interfaces, or cooling technologies.
    • Optimizing the thermal performance of optical transceivers to meet design specifications and operational requirements.
Technical Knowledge & Skills
  • Simulation Software Proficiency: Experience with thermal simulation software (e.g., Solidworks, ANSYS, COMSOL).
  • Thermal Analysis: Strong understanding of heat transfer principles, fluid mechanics, and thermal modeling techniques.
  • Validation and Characterization: Experience with thermal testing, data analysis, and statistical methods.
Education & Experience Requirements
  • Education: Bachelor's or Master's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Collaboration: 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ams, including design, manufacturing, and test engineers.
  • Problem-Solving: Ability to identify and resolve thermal issues in optical transceiver designs.
